O'DEA (Eamon Laurence) (Raheny and Clontarf) (retired Senior Lecturer in the College of Marketing, Dublin) - Serenely on the Feast of St. Catherine of Sienna, 29th of April, 2006, in the exceptional care of Religious Sisters, Dr. Frank O'Driscoll and staff of St. Gabriel's, Glenayle Road, Raheny, in the presence of his loving wife Madge and family. Loving father of the late Br. Liam OFM Capuchin; very sadly missed by his son Eamon, daughters Máire Bríd and Edel, son-in-law David, daughter-in-law Máire, grandchildren Eamon, Máirtín and Éilís, brothers, sister, relatives and friends. Removal today (Tuesday), May 2 after prayers to Mother of Divine Grace Church, Raheny village arriving at 6 o'clock Requiem Mass tomorrow (Wednesday) at 11.30 o'clockockand afterwards to Glasnevin Cemetery. Family flowers only. Donations if desired to Capuchin Mission Office, Church Street, Dublin 7. A wonderful husband and father. ''Solas na bhFlaitheas dá anam dílis''
